Book excerpt: Communism and Nationalism in Colonial India, 1939-45 is an incisive and original contribution to our understanding of the Communist Party of India`s approach towards the Indian national movement and British colonialism from 1939 to 1945. Based on extensive use of archival material, private papers and rare documents, the book is a critique of both the official CPI line as well as its detractors` opinions about the Party`s role in the said period. It analyses in detail both points of view with regard to why the CPI failed to expose what it termed as the `betrayal` of the `bourgeois nationalist` leadership and why it was not able to establish its `hegemony` over the Indian freedom struggle-to transform the bourgeois democratic revolution into a socialist revolution. Book excerpt: In The Long-Drawn Political Struggle For Complete Independence From The Colonial Rule The Role Of E.M.S. Namboodiripad Is Unique In The Annals Of Our History. He Is A Dedicated True Patriot Who Offered His Services To The Nation At A Fairly Young Age. He Suffered In Jails Along With Millions Of Satyagrah Is And Thus Showed His Remarkable Sense Of Discipline, Dedication And Patriotic Fervor. He Was A Gandhian But Later On I.E. Became A Marxist. As Chief Minister Of Kerala He Carried On Several Development Schemes For The Socio-Economic Development Of His People. He Is A Prolific Writer.
